Expoint - all jobs in one place

Finding the best job has never been easier

Limitless High-tech career opportunities - Expoint

Microsoft Senior Technical Program Manager – Rust Tooling 
Czechia, Prague, Prague 
703258633

11.06.2024

Required/Minimum Qualifications:

  • Bachelor's Degree AND extensive experience in engineering, product/technical program management, data analysis, or product development
    • OR equivalent experience.
  • Experience managing cross-functional and/or cross-team projects.

Preferred Qualifications:

  • Bachelor's degree in Computer Science, Computer Engineering, Software Engineering, or a related field, or equivalent skills, and/or practical experience
  • Extensive experience in a software development, technical program management, or a similar role delivering platform or service features
  • Experience with driving compliance areas in a software development setting
  • Experience reading and/or writing/creating documentation/specifications/project artifacts
  • Experience in software development or dev-ops

Ability to meet Microsoft, customer and/or government security screening requirements are required for this role. These requirements include, but are not limited to the following specialized security screenings:

Microsoft Cloud Background Check: This position will be required to pass the Microsoft Cloud Background Check upon hire/transfer and every two years thereafter.

Responsibilities
  • Help identify and deliver against program Objectives and Key Results (OKRs) by coordinating the team’s strategy and tactics.
  • Partner with stakeholders and contributors to define the plan for each release and collaborate closely with engineering teams to deliver per plan.
  • Partner with the internal Rust community and strategic Microsoft teams to manage a tight feedback loop to strengthen Rust tooling and drive these requirements across engineering teams to deliver on these goals.
  • Work with all major fundamental areas including security, reliability, compatibility, inter-operability, accessibility, privacy, globalization/localization, and more.
  • Assist engineers on the team navigate these requirements and undertake projects that increase the level of reliability and automation of tooling adoptions and reduce overall developer toil.
  • Manage dependencies across multiple work streams to identify potential risk areas through data-driven approaches and identify areas of optimization.
  • Contribute to our shared vision of an inclusive team where everyone can be their authentic selves and do their best.